Output 33105783e94f0404d90fd260ee74468732df9816a158b4827a1d434313262277:0

value
56520015
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d10a56cfb107dabc930914447d36ad89a3778fce OP_EQUALVERIFY OP_CHECKSIG
address
1L4JcU3Zm9aDLf1VaKyZn7ZEBz29wHo27a
transaction
33105783e94f0404d90fd260ee74468732df9816a158b4827a1d434313262277
spent
true